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A hair cutting appliance is configured to be moved through hair in a moving direction in order to cut hair. The hair cutting appliance includes a housing portion, a blade set having a skin-facing top surface, and a releasable attachment comb. The blade set is arranged pivotably with respect to the housing portion. The attachment comb includes a supporting frame, at least one spacing guard element configured to space the blade set from a working surface when in operation, a mounting portion configured to be attached to a housing portion of the hair cutting appliance, and an orientation determining portion configured to engage the blade set and to define a locking orientation of the blade set when mounted to the hair cutting appliance.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

The invention claimed is: 1. A hair cutting appliance configured to be moved through hair in a moving direction to cut the hair, said hair cutting appliance comprising: a housing; a blade set configured to pivotably move during a shaving mode with respect to the housing and be in a locking orientation during a hair trimming mode; and a releasable attachment comb configured to be coupled to the housing in the hair trimming mode and to fix the blade set in the locking orientation during the hair trimming mode, the releasable attachment comb comprising: a supporting frame, and a mount having a hook, the hook pivotably attached to the supporting frame and configured to be attached to the housing of the hair cutting appliance, wherein the releasable attachment comb comprises an orientation determiner configured to engage the blade set and to define the locking orientation of the blade set and fix the blade set in the locking orientation in the hair trimming mode when the releasable attachment comb is mounted to the housing, and wherein the orientation determiner of the releasable attachment comb is configured to swivel the blade set against a swivel limit stop associated with the housing in response to attachment of the releasable attachment comb to the housing. 2. The hair cutting appliance of claim 1 , wherein the hair cutting appliance further comprises a swivel configured to couple the blade set to the housing of the hair cutting appliance, and wherein the orientation determiner of the releasable attachment comb is configured to block the swivel to attain the locking orientation during the hair trimming mode. 3. The hair cutting appliance of claim 1 , wherein the hook has a sliding surface configured to cooperate with a sliding ramp surface associated with a mounting contour at the housing, and wherein the sliding surface and the sliding ramp surface deflect the hook upon mounting the attachment comb such that a retaining surface of the hook engages an engagement surface associated with the mounting contour. 4. The hair cutting appliance of claim 1 , wherein the hook is a resilient snap-on hook, wherein the resilient snap-on hook is configured to engage a mounting contour at the housing, wherein the resilient snap-on hook biases against the mounting contour when mounted to the housing, wherein the resilient snap-on hook is configured to apply an alignment force to the housing when mounted to the housing to urge the blade set into the locking orientation, and wherein the alignment force urges the orientation determiner into engagement with the blade set to attain the locking orientation of the blade set in the hair trimming mode. 5. The hair cutting appliance of claim 1 , wherein the orientation determiner includes a guide configured to contact and guide the blade set for aligning the blade set with the releasable attachment comb in the mounted state, and wherein the guide is offset away from a first lateral side of lateral sides of the supporting frame leaving a gap between the guide and the first lateral side. 6. The hair cutting appliance of claim 1 , wherein the releasable attachment comb comprises a handling tab, and wherein the handling tab is configured to disengage the hook from the housing in response to pushing the handling tab in a disengagement direction, the disengagement direction being parallel to the supporting frame. 7. The hair cutting appliance of claim 1 , wherein the releasable attachment comb comprises at least one spacing guard, the at least one spacing guard configured to space the blade set from a working surface when in operation, and wherein the at least one spacing guard of the releasable attachment comb is located at a first end of the supporting frame of the releasable attachment comb and the hook is located at a second end of the supporting frame opposite the first end. 8. The hair cutting appliance of claim 1 , wherein the hook is rotatably movable between an engagement position for engaging the housing of the hair cutting appliance and a disengagement position for disengaging from the housing, and wherein the hook extends away from the supporting frame in both the engagement position and the disengagement position. 9. A hair cutting appliance configured to be moved through hair in a moving direction to cut the hair, said hair cutting appliance comprising: a housing; a blade set configured to pivotably move during a shaving mode with respect to the housing; and a releasable attachment comb configured to be releasably coupled to the housing in a hair trimming mode and configured to fix the blade set in a locking orientation during the hair trimming mode when coupled to the housing to prevent pivotal movement of the blade set in both clockwise and counter-clockwise directions, wherein the hair cutting appliance is configured for the blade set to be released from the locking orientation in response to removal of the releasable attachment comb from the housing, wherein the releasable attachment comb includes a supporting frame and an orientation determiner, the orientation determiner being configured to engage the blade set and to define the locking orientation of the blade set and fix the blade set in the locking orientation in the hair trimming mode when the releasable attachment comb is in a mounted state, where the releasable attachment comb is mounted to the housing in the mounted state, and wherein the orientation determiner of the releasable attachment comb is configured to swivel the blade set against a blade set orientation biasing force applied by a biaser associated with the housing in response to attachment of the releasable attachment comb to the housing. 10. The hair cutting appliance of claim 9 , wherein the releasable attachment comb comprises: a mount having a hook, and a mounting pivot, the hook being rotatably attached to the supporting frame by the mounting pivot, and the hook being configured to be attached to the housing of the hair cutting appliance. 11. The hair cutting appliance of claim 9 , wherein the hair cutting appliance comprises a swivel configured to couple the blade set to the housing of the hair cutting appliance, and wherein the orientation determiner of the releasable attachment comb is configured to block the swivel to attain the locking orientation during the hair trimming mode. 12. The hair cutting appliance of claim 9 , wherein the orientation determiner includes a receiving seat that contacts a top surface of the blade set when the releasable attachment comb is in the mounted state, and wherein a length of the receiving seat exceeds at least half a length of the blade set. 13.
